Transaction f7b57668308ab81e8794723ddb51323b0d36c6d52939f0d95e0bd92f09b72a8e
1 Input
1 Output
-
f7b57668308ab81e8794723ddb51323b0d36c6d52939f0d95e0bd92f09b72a8e:0
- value
- 345709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1eebb52c5a980c4ea1e25483cd103e9a4b7a7606 OP_EQUAL
- address
- 34WWZZH86NntAGvNWvyCS5egSYxPUUV72V